Job description

The Stock Coordinator is responsible for the control and disposal of unsalvageable parts and expired parts and products while also overseeing inventory for our Landing Gear MRO department. This position ensures that all necessary parts and materials are accurately stocked, tracked, and available to support maintenance and repair activities.

Tasks

The key responsibilities and duties of the Stock Coordinator include, but are not limited to:

  • Controlling and managing the handling and storage of unsalvageable/scrap parts according to defined processes.
  • Ensuring that scrap parts are moved to the designated scrap storage area in compliance with established procedures.
  • Coordinating with product lines to ensure scrap parts are available for customer viewing.
  • Collaborating closely with product lines to support customer requirements.
  • Working with product lines and finance to ensure timely disposal of scrap parts.
  • Maintaining documentation for scrap parts as per defined processes.
  • Monitoring the remaining shelf life of parts and products with limited shelf life.
  • Disposing of parts or products nearing expiration in accordance with defined procedures.
  • Promoting required standards of work.
  • Upholding and maintaining standards of general housekeeping.
  • Controlling and managing the process of taking pictures of scrap parts.
